Back by popular demand

DanceAway is very happy to announce we will be re-introducing our monthly Tea Dance at St Mark's Church Hall in Wallisdown, Bournemouth, BH10 4HY

A mix of Ballroom, Latin American & Popular Sequence Dancing

1.45pm - 3.45pm

Large Hall

Free Car Parking on site

Free Tea/Coffee & Biscuits included

All Abilities Welcome

(Please note we are unable to supply host dancers so please try to attend with a partner or within a group)

For full details of this event, forthcoming Evening and Afternoon Tea Dances, together with all classes currently on offer at DanceAway, please visit www.dance-away.co.uk
